QFrameAction¶
Provides a way to have a synchronous function executed each frame. More…
Detailed Description¶
The QFrameAction
provides a way to perform tasks each frame in a synchronized way with the Qt3D backend. This is useful to implement some aspects of application logic and to prototype functionality that can later be folded into an additional Qt3D aspect.
For example, the QFrameAction
can be used to animate a property in sync with the Qt3D engine where a Qt Quick animation element is not perfectly synchronized and may lead to stutters in some cases.
To execute your own code each frame connect to the triggered
signal.
- class PySide6.Qt3DLogic.Qt3DLogic.QFrameAction([parent=None])¶
- Parameters
parent –
PySide6.Qt3DCore.Qt3DCore.QNode
Constructs a new QFrameAction
instance with parent parent
.
- PySide6.Qt3DLogic.Qt3DLogic.QFrameAction.triggered(dt)¶
- Parameters
dt – float
© 2022 The Qt Company Ltd. Documentation contributions included herein are the copyrights of their respective owners. The documentation provided herein is licensed under the terms of the GNU Free Documentation License version 1.3 as published by the Free Software Foundation. Qt and respective logos are trademarks of The Qt Company Ltd. in Finland and/or other countries worldwide. All other trademarks are property of their respective owners.